
Gregor Townsend
Gregor Townsend is a Scottish rugby union coach and former player, currently serving as the head coach of the Scotland national team. He was in the news for making a controversial decision to select a 6-2 bench split in a recent match, which left his team vulnerable to injuries and highlighted ongoing concerns about player safety in rugby.
